The Constant Power Control of Hydraulic Grinding Saw

Article Preview

Abstract:

Hydraulic grinding saw is a kind of important equipment broadly used in billet precise cutting in metallurgical industry. In order to improve productivity significantly, control feeding speed reasonably, at the same time to compensate the variation of driving torque caused by the change of contacting area between grinding wheel and slab, thus to obtain the optimized match between the feed of the grinding wheel and the driving motor, the application of hydraulic servo system in the control of the feeding speed of grinding wheel is discussed in this thesis. This article introduces the principle of hydraulic grinding saw, brings out the project of constant power PID control based on the relationship between driving torque and motor current. The transfer function of the hydraulic servo system, the optimized PID controller is also worked out. According to the result of simulation analysis, the controlling factors can be well obtained.
